In Kenya, business companies play a significant role in driving economic growth and providing employment opportunities for the local workforce. One crucial aspect of a company's relationship with its employees is the compensation and benefits it offers. Ensuring fair employment compensation is essential not only for attracting and retaining top talents but also for promoting employee satisfaction and productivity. Employment compensation in Kenyan business companies typically includes a combination of salary, bonuses, benefits, and perks. It is essential for companies to establish transparent and equitable compensation policies to ensure that employees are fairly rewarded for their contributions. This includes conducting regular reviews of salary structures to stay competitive in the market and align with industry standards. Many Kenyan business companies have started to prioritize employee well-being by offering competitive salaries, performance-based bonuses, health insurance, retirement plans, and other benefits. Providing a comprehensive benefits package not only helps attract top talents but also enhances employee loyalty and engagement. However, challenges such as gender pay gaps and disparities between different job levels still exist in the Kenyan business landscape. Companies need to address these disparities by implementing pay equity measures and ensuring that all employees are compensated fairly for their work regardless of their gender or position within the organization. Employee compensation is not just about financial rewards but also about recognition and appreciation for the hard work and dedication employees put into their roles. Recognizing and rewarding outstanding performance through bonuses, promotions, or other incentives can motivate employees to perform at their best and contribute to the company's success. Ultimately, Kenyan business companies play a crucial role in promoting fair employment compensation practices that benefit both the company and its employees. By prioritizing transparent, equitable, and competitive compensation policies, companies can create a positive work environment where employees feel valued, motivated, and invested in the company's success.
